两种岩石地球化学图解在确定岩石同化,混染成因方面的应用
引用本文:王建,李碧乐.两种岩石地球化学图解在确定岩石同化,混染成因方面的应用[J].世界地质,1997,16(4):20-25.
作者姓名:王建  李碧乐
作者单位:地球科学学院
摘    要:首先介绍了两种简易岩石地球化学图解,即元素,元素对比值混合方程和混染岩,混染端员元素浓度差相关性图解。进而应用这两种图解配合其它地质事实共同验证了冀东迁西上营-十八盘地区的云英闪长质片麻岩是由奥长花岩是由奥长花岗岩浆对角闪质岩石不同程度同化,混染形成的。

关 键 词:岩石  地球化学  相关性图解  岩石同化  混染成因

Application of Lithogeochemical Diagrams to Verify Tonalitic Gneiss of Assimilation and Contamination
Wang Jian, Li Bile.Application of Lithogeochemical Diagrams to Verify Tonalitic Gneiss of Assimilation and Contamination[J].World Geology,1997,16(4):20-25.
Authors:Wang Jian  Li Bile
Abstract:This article first makes a brief introduction about two lithogeochemical diagrams. One is mixed equation diagram of pairs of elements and element ratios, and theother is element concentration difference diagram of contaminated rock and contaminatedminal.The two lithogeochemical diagrams together with some other geological facts jointlytest and verify the fact that the tonalitic gneiss in Shangying - Shibapan area, easternHebei province was formed by assimilation and contamination, the two contaminated minals are old plutonic intrusive type trondhjemitic magmas and amphibolite.
Keywords:mixed equation diagram of pairs of elements and element ratios  element concentration difference diagram  assimilation and contamination
